博客 高效数据可视化实现:指标工具的技术优化方案

高效数据可视化实现:指标工具的技术优化方案

   数栈君   发表于 2025-12-23 18:31  102  0

在当今数字化转型的浪潮中,数据可视化已成为企业决策的重要工具。通过直观的图表和仪表盘,企业能够快速理解复杂的数据,从而做出更明智的商业决策。然而,数据可视化的核心在于“高效”,这不仅要求工具能够处理海量数据,还需要在性能、交互性和用户体验上达到最优状态。本文将深入探讨如何通过技术优化实现高效的指标工具,为企业提供更强大的数据可视化能力。


一、数据可视化的重要性

在数据驱动的时代,企业每天都会产生海量数据。如何从这些数据中提取有价值的信息,是企业面临的首要挑战。数据可视化通过将复杂的数据转化为易于理解的图表、仪表盘等形式,帮助企业快速识别趋势、发现异常,并支持实时决策。

1.1 数据可视化的核心价值

  • 快速决策:通过直观的图表,用户可以快速理解数据,减少分析时间。
  • 数据驱动的洞察:可视化能够揭示数据中的隐藏模式,为企业提供更深层次的洞察。
  • 跨部门协作:数据可视化工具支持多人协作,便于团队共享数据和分析结果。

1.2 指标工具的定义与作用

指标工具是一种专门用于数据可视化和分析的软件,它通过整合多种数据源,生成动态的仪表盘和报告。指标工具的核心功能包括:

  • 数据采集与整合
  • 数据清洗与处理
  • 可视化设计与展示
  • 实时监控与告警

二、高效数据可视化的关键技术

要实现高效的指标工具,技术优化是核心。以下是实现高效数据可视化的关键技术点:

2.1 数据处理与计算优化

数据处理是数据可视化的基础。高效的指标工具需要具备快速处理和计算的能力,尤其是在处理大规模数据时。

  • 分布式计算:通过分布式计算技术(如MapReduce、Spark),指标工具可以快速处理海量数据。
  • 流数据处理:对于实时数据流,工具需要支持低延迟的处理和更新,以确保仪表盘的实时性。
  • 数据清洗与预处理:在数据可视化之前,工具需要对数据进行清洗和预处理,以确保数据的准确性和完整性。

2.2 可视化引擎的优化

可视化引擎是数据可视化的核心组件。优化可视化引擎可以显著提升数据展示的性能和效果。

  • 高性能渲染:通过优化图形渲染算法,工具可以在短时间内生成高质量的图表。
  • 动态交互:支持用户与图表的交互操作(如缩放、筛选、钻取),提升用户体验。
  • 多维度数据展示:通过多维度的数据分析和展示,用户可以更全面地理解数据。

2.3 数据源的整合与管理

指标工具需要支持多种数据源的整合,包括数据库、API、文件等。高效的工具还需要具备强大的数据源管理能力。

  • 数据源的自动发现:工具可以自动发现和连接多种数据源,减少手动配置的工作量。
  • 数据同步与更新:支持数据的自动同步和更新,确保数据的实时性。
  • 数据安全与权限管理:通过数据安全和权限管理功能,确保数据的安全性和合规性。

三、指标工具的技术优化方案

为了实现高效的指标工具,企业需要从以下几个方面进行技术优化:

3.1 选择合适的可视化框架

选择一个合适的可视化框架是实现高效数据可视化的第一步。以下是一些常见的可视化框架:

  • D3.js:一个强大的数据可视化库,支持自定义图表和交互。
  • ECharts:一个基于JavaScript的开源图表库,支持多种图表类型。
  • Tableau:一个功能强大的商业智能工具,支持数据可视化和分析。

3.2 优化数据处理流程

数据处理是数据可视化的关键环节。以下是一些优化数据处理流程的建议:

  • 数据分片:将大规模数据分片处理,减少计算压力。
  • 数据缓存:通过缓存技术减少重复计算,提升性能。
  • 数据压缩:通过数据压缩技术减少数据传输和存储的开销。

3.3 提升用户交互体验

用户交互体验是数据可视化工具的重要组成部分。以下是一些提升用户交互体验的建议:

  • 动态交互:支持用户与图表的动态交互,如缩放、筛选、钻取等。
  • 自定义视图:允许用户自定义图表样式和布局,满足个性化需求。
  • 实时更新:支持数据的实时更新,确保仪表盘的实时性。

3.4 优化性能与扩展性

性能与扩展性是数据可视化工具的重要指标。以下是一些优化性能与扩展性的建议:

  • 分布式架构:通过分布式架构提升工具的扩展性和性能。
  • 负载均衡:通过负载均衡技术分担服务器压力,提升工具的稳定性。
  • 弹性扩展:支持根据数据量自动调整资源,确保工具的灵活性。

四、案例分析:高效指标工具的应用场景

为了更好地理解高效指标工具的应用场景,我们可以通过以下案例进行分析:

4.1 案例一:实时监控与告警

某电商平台使用高效指标工具进行实时监控和告警。通过工具的实时数据处理和可视化功能,平台可以快速发现异常流量,并及时采取措施。

4.2 案例二:多维度数据分析

某金融公司使用高效指标工具进行多维度数据分析。通过工具的多维度数据展示功能,公司可以全面了解市场趋势,并做出更明智的投资决策。

4.3 案例三:数据驱动的营销

某零售企业使用高效指标工具进行数据驱动的营销。通过工具的实时数据分析和可视化功能,企业可以快速调整营销策略,并提升销售业绩。


五、总结与展望

高效数据可视化是企业数字化转型的重要组成部分。通过技术优化,指标工具可以实现更快的数据处理、更优的可视化效果和更好的用户体验。未来,随着技术的不断进步,指标工具将变得更加智能化和自动化,为企业提供更强大的数据可视化能力。


申请试用:如果您希望体验高效的指标工具,可以申请试用我们的产品,了解更多功能和优势。

申请试用:我们的产品支持多种数据源的整合与分析,帮助您快速实现数据可视化。

申请试用:立即体验高效的数据可视化工具,提升您的数据分析能力。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料